My recent visit to Piezano left much to be desired. Despite the hefty price tag of nearly $5 per slice, the quality of the pizza fell short of expectations. One would typically associate such prices with downtown establishments known for their premium offerings, but unfortunately, this wasn't the case in the Brighton Park area.Beyond the exorbitant pricing, the wait time of approximately 7 minutes every visit for a single slice only added to the disappointment. In an area where quick and delicious options are valued, the prolonged wait was simply unjustifiable and rendered the experience even less enjoyable.Overall, my experience at Piezano was underwhelming, and I would recommend exploring other options in the area for better value and taste.
